Description A WASHER/DRYER
[0001] The present invention relates to a washer/dryer of which the washing performance is enhanced.
[0002] The operation performance of washer/dryers particularly washing machines varies depending on the environmental conditions therein that are operated. The values pertaining to parameters determined as a result of various tests conducted by the producer can change depending on the conditions of the environment in which the machine will be used and this adversely affects the washing performance.
[0003] Particularly the voltage values from the electric network and the temperature of water from the water supply can vary momentarily or periodically depending on the geographic locations, seasonal conditions and other similar conditions. The decreases in the network voltage or the temperature of the water supply affect the operation duration of heaters that heat the water to be used in the washing process. Thus it increases the time period for water to reach the desired temperature and adversely affects the washing performance.
[0004] In cases when the desired temperature cannot be attained due to momentary or continuous decreases that may occur in the network voltage or the temperature of the water received from the water supply, the substances that provide foaming in the detergent, cleaning agent etc. are activated more. This condition results in generation of more foaming, which adversely affects the washing performance and also discharging the generated foam from the machine becomes harder.
[0005] In the state of the art Japanese Patent Application No JP2000237488, the rotation period of the motor is changed according to a signal from a voltage detection means detecting power source voltage, the signal of a temperature detection means detecting temperature, or set water level.
[0006] The aim of the present invention is the realization of a washer/dryer that is affected minimally from the variations in temperature of water received from the water supply and changes in the network voltage.
[0007] The washer/dryer realized in order to attain the aim of the present invention, explicated in the first claim and the respective claims thereof, comprises a control unit that changes the heating duration and the durations of washing steps according to variations in the temperature of the water supply or changes in the network voltage.
[0008] The heating duration and/or the durations of the washing steps are changed so that the momentary and/or continuous decreases that may occur in the network voltage do not prevent reaching the target temperature in the heating time period determined by the producer.
[0009] The heating duration and/or the durations of the washing steps are changed so that the momentary and/or continuous decreases that may occur in the temperature of the water supply do not prevent reaching the target temperature in the heating time period determined by the producer.
[0010] By means of the present invention, in cases when the target temperature cannot be attained in the time period determined by the producer depending on variations in the network voltage and/or the water supply temperature, the substances that provide foaming in the detergent, cleaning agent etc. are prevented from staying at temperatures wherein they are activated more.

[0014] The washer/dryer (1) comprises a washing tub (2) wherein laundry to be washed is emplaced, one or more heaters (3) for heating the water to be used in the washing process and a control unit (4) that measures the temperature of the water supply or the network voltage and determines the time period for the heater (3) to operate and/or the durations of the washing steps depending on these values (Figure 1).
[0015] The washing performance is kept at the desired level adjusting the time period for the heater (3) to operate and/or the durations of the washing steps by the control unit (4) according to variations in the temperature of the water supply or the network voltage.
[0016] The network voltage or the temperature of the water supply is recorded in the control unit (4) in order to keep the washing performance at the targeted level.
[0017] The electrical components of the washer/dryer (1) are supplied by the network voltage. The minimum network voltage (Vm1n) for maintaining the washing performance determined by the producer is compared with the measured momentary network voltage value (Vnetwork). If the network voltage (Vnetwork) value is less than the minimum network voltage value (Vm1n), then the time period for the heater (3) to operate is increased by a coefficient specified by the producer.
[0018] The water to be used in washer/dryers (1) is supplied by the water supply. The minimum water supply temperature (T1111n) for providing the washing performance determined by the producer is compared with the measured momentary temperature of the water supply (Tsuppiy). If the temperature of the water supply (Tsuppiy) is lower than the minimum water supply temperature (T1111n), then the time period for the heater (3) to operate is increased by a coefficient specified by the producer.
[0019] By means of the present invention, the heating duration, the duration of the washing step after heating and the duration of the rinsing step are adjusted according to the network voltage or the water supply temperature to provide the washing performance to be affected minimally from variations in the supply sources.

Claims

Claims
[0001] A washer/dryer (1) comprising a washing tub (2) wherein laundry to be washed is emplaced, and one or more heaters (3) for heating the water to be used in the washing process and characterized by a control unit (4) that measures the temperature of the water supply or the network voltage and determines the time period for the heater (3) to operate and/or the durations of the washing steps depending on that measured values.
[0002] A washer/dryer (1) as in Claim 1, characterized by the control unit (4) that compares the minimum network voltage (Vm1n) determined by the producer with the measured momentary network voltage value (VnetWork) and increases the time period for the heater (3) to operate by a coefficient specified by the producer if the network voltage value (VnetWork) is less than the minimum network voltage (V minj.
[0003] A washer/dryer (1) as in Claim 1 or 2, characterized by the control unit (4) that compares the minimum water supply temperature (T1111n) determined by the producer with the measured momentary temperature of the water supply (Tsuppiy) and increases the time period for the heater (3) to operate by a coefficient specified by the producer if the temperature of the water supply (Tsuppiy) is lower than the minimum water supply temperature (Tm1n).
